Bioactivity-guided isolation of aurone derivatives with hepatoprotective activities from the fruits of Cucumis bisexualis
Zeitschrift für Naturforschung C ( IF 1.8 ) Pub Date : 2020-09-25 , DOI: 10.1515/znc-2019-0202
Qin-Ge Ma 1 , Rong-Rui Wei 2 , Zhi-Pei Sang 3
Affiliation  

Abstract Bioactivity-guided phytochemical investigation of Cucumis bisexualis has led to the isolation of three new coumarin-aurone heterodimers (1-3), along with six aurone derivatives (4-9) were isolated from C. bisexualis for the first time. Their structures were determined by their extensive spectroscopic data and comparison with the values reported in the references. All isolated compounds (1-9) were evaluated for their hepatoprotective activities on human L-O2 cells, which compared with positive control of Bifendatatum. Among them, compounds 1, 2, and 7 exhibited moderate hepatoprotective activities to promote effects on the proliferation of L-O2 cells.
